New Favourite Cookbook
"Quinoa 365: The Everyday Superfood" is a quietly unassuming book that packs quite a punch. To say I was caught off guard by how much I enjoyed this book is an understatement. Every recipe I tried was a success. Authors Patricia Green and Carolyn Hemming provide you with an overall education on quinoa, along with exciting new ways to use this seed and truly bring it to life. The book is beautifully photographed, and a wide variety of recipes are included that show you how quinoa can be used as breakfast foods, snacks, salads, soups, in baking and for baby food.
